Output 39334e233a091c39d77c8eb0041cf7a4b9d83e397703a3e147a2375d72165159:2

value
883924392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e134a363388f437336fe3da7659d43f6c1d10b06 OP_EQUAL
address
3NDo25FcjpDQyfEtm3sQuBfeFAwrsE5Wgc
transaction
39334e233a091c39d77c8eb0041cf7a4b9d83e397703a3e147a2375d72165159
spent
true